Description: File Roller is an archive manager utility for the GNOME desktop environment. It allows users to create, view, edit, and unpack various archive file formats like zip, tar, rar, 7z and more. As a default archive manager in GNOME, File Roller offers an easy-to-use interface to compress and extract files.

File Roller
File Roller Features
  • Compress and extract various archive formats like zip, tar, rar, 7z, etc.
  • Integrated into the GNOME desktop environment
  • Easy to use graphical interface
  • Open, view, edit, and extract archives
  • Create new archives
  • Add and remove files from existing archives
  • Password protection for archives
  • Drag and drop support
  • Context menu actions for archives
  • Command line interface
